      <description>&lt;P&gt;For anyone who still has this question, since 2021 it IS now possible to load .obj files plus their textures and display them in Fusion. If you are not seeing textures displayed, the first 3 things to check are: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;1. When you first import the .obj file, it should have a corresponding .mtl and .png/.jpg in the same folder&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;2. Make sure you turn OFF display face groups&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;3.
